Physics has long been recognized as constituting the basis for study, research, and understanding in the natural sciences.

Our undergraduate major program seeks to provide a broad and general background in all areas of physics. We also provide opportunities to learn a variety of skills useful in STEM fields.

Recent graduates have tech jobs with: Elphas (cancer therapy development), Jacobs (business consulting and services), Indeed (online job site), Lockheed Martin, Dynaboard (web development), Wolfspeed (semiconductor electronics), Northrup Grumman, Cycle Labs (software development), and IBM.

Recent graduates obtained (or are pursuing) PhDs from: Rensselaer Polytechnic Inst, North Carolina SU, Univ Texas-Dallas, Univ Texas-Austin, Wake Forest Univ, and JSNN.

This program is being discontinued pending SACSCOC approval and is not accepting applications for admission. The University is still authorized to offer the program and issue the associated credential for students who are currently enrolled in the program.
